About The Position

This role involves delivering patient care using the nursing process. The nurse will assess learning needs and implement appropriate teaching strategies for diverse patient populations, families, and other groups. Responsibilities include effective communication, delegation, and management of nursing team resources, acting as a leader and partner within an interdisciplinary team. The position also requires using data and information to evaluate and promote change for optimal outcomes, embracing concepts that enhance customer satisfaction, employee morale, and professional nursing improvement. Additionally, the nurse must adapt their behavior to specific patient populations, respecting privacy, introducing themselves appropriately, explaining services and procedures, seeking permissions, and using a suitable communication style. Requirements

  • Current registered nurse (RN) license in state of practice.
  • Current Basic Life Support (BLS) certification from the American Heart Association.
  • Registered nurse diploma.
  • Proficiency in using computers, software, and web-based applications.
  • Effective verbal and written communication skills and ability to present information clearly and professionally to varying levels of individuals throughout the patient care process.
  • Excellent organizational and time management skills.

Nice To Haves

  • Associate or bachelor's degree in nursing.
  • Certification in clinical specialty area.
